Output a62ef3ce23dfd130d960e6e8cfe5cfa11cb501ece682d2d0fdc4aa5180d464e6:0

value
18513687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31f73a0dd6366650232a8d89cbb6b87d626a0027 OP_EQUAL
address
36FDCZUrQicEDyFsFhP3UduTgJ1c9mS5yA
transaction
a62ef3ce23dfd130d960e6e8cfe5cfa11cb501ece682d2d0fdc4aa5180d464e6
spent
true